Tent problem continues in Maraş 2023-03-05 13:13:36   MARAŞ- Citizens who still have tent and food problems in the center of Maraş, hold on to life in tents they set up from the iron they dug out of the tarpaulin and rubble they bought with their own means.   While there was heavy destruction in Maraş, the epicenter of the earthquake, thousands of people lost their lives in the central Dulkadiroğlu and February 12 districts. Many people whose houses were destroyed and damaged are still trying to solve the problem of shelter by their own means. Citizens who prefer high regions that are not affected much by the earthquake are deprived of food aid this time.   Many people, whose building was destroyed in Sütçü İmam Neighborhood of Dulkadiroğlu district, could not find a place in the tent cities. Citizens, who are not provided with tents despite their demands, try to hold on to life in tents they set up from tarpaulins in the higher parts of Beyazıt Neighborhood, which they see as safer.   EARTHQUAKE VICTIM CAN'T FIND TENTS   Stating that they turned the tarpaulins they bought with their own means into tents with the iron they obtained from the construction rubble, Mehmet Koca said: “We are trying to do as much as we can. There is destruction, there are buildings to be demolished. There are cracked buildings. Some are afraid and cannot enter the apartment. Everyone is trying to do something with their own means. We did not even know where to make the tent request, we were first told that we would have applied via e-government, but then we were directed elsewhere. We are looking for it, but it does not work. Someone says 122. Someone says 144. Everyone is saying something. We're looking for them, they're directing them here and there. They call it AFAD. Everyone says something."   NO WATER AND ELECTRICITY   Stating that they do not have water and electricity and that there are still days after the earthquake, Koca said: “There are 10-15 people staying in each tent. We likewise. We are trying to do something with our own means. Some of us stay in the car and continue. No dry food. The meal comes every once in a while. It is not clear whether the food is coming or not. There is no mayor either.”   MA / Ahmet Kanbal
